Transfer Student is the fourth episode of the second season of Meta Runner.

Plot[]

In her room, Tari boots up and enters the "Pocket Gakusei" game in search for Lamar. While there she meets Kizuna AI acting as an in-game guide, who agrees to help her find her friend.

Meanwhile with Belle she meets up with Theo who calls her "Shouty Lady" and Belle annoyingly goes along with it. She performs a glitch to help Theo escape the saferoom, leaving Lucks' minions shocked. Inside, Belle tells Theo to find files pertaining to Lucinia's disappearance.

Back with Tari, they find a girl named Satsuki-chan, but she doesn't respond upon Tari's attempts to talk to her. This being a dating simulator, Kizuna AI tells Tari how the game works.

Theo finally finds the files on Lucinia, but the security finds Theo, leading Belle to try and assist Theo in fighting off the security bots through the means of speedrunning tricks. They fend off the bot swarms as they wait for the file to finish loading. However, a guard notices that someone has been tinkering in the lab, and upon checking, Belle manages to get away in time, however leaving Theo behind. As Lucks once again is notified of Theo's second escape attempt into the server, he decides to transfer Theo from the safe room into the broken cartridge, trapping him in a glitched version of the game. The credits roll differs from the usual credits, showing Tari bonding with Satsuki in-game as well as Theo trapped in the glitched game.

Trivia[]

  • This is the very first Meta Runner episode to have a special guest who does not speak English. The guest is the popular virtual YouTuber, Kizuna AI.
  • While looking for Lucinia's file, Theo comes across "Spletzer files" and blueprints for the "W.A.H. Launcher", referencing Meggy Spletzer and the Waluigi Launcher from the SMG4 series.
  • This episode's title, "Transfer Student", is not a video game term itself, but is rather a reference to what this episode is about. It's about Tari's first time playing Pocket Gakusei. In short, this title is a reference to the in-series mobile dating sim (game),Pocket Gakusei.
  • The style of the episode's credits might be referencing the credits roll of the game Doki Doki Literature Club!
